Effective Pimple Treatments with Benzoyl Peroxide

The most effective pimple treatments usually contain benzoyl peroxide. Benzoyl peroxide works for most people because it uses a three-pronged attack to eliminate acne. First, it breaks up sebum that clogs skin pores. This makes it possible for the product to get inside of the pore instead of simply treating the exterior. Once the benzoyl peroxide product gets inside the pore, it can eliminate acne-causing bacteria. This allows the skin to start healing. In the meantime, benzoyl peroxide prevents future outbreaks by introducing more oxygen to the skin. This creates an environment that is inhospitable to bacteria.

Effective Pimple Treatments for Sensitive Skin

Sensitive skin presents a problem for many people who have acne. Benzoyl peroxide, although one of the most effective pimple treatments, can cause side effects in people with sensitive skin. The side effects usually include dry, flaking, or peeling skin. In rare cases, benzoyl peroxide can cause the skin to swell. None of these side effects are particularly dangerous, but they can cause itchiness and irritation. The side effects can also make your skin look worse than it does when you have a breakout of pimples.

If you have sensitive or dry skin, then you should choose a pimple treatment that contains an oil-free moisturizer. You might even find an effective pimple treatment that contains benzoyl peroxide and moisturizers. Effective Pimple Treatment without Side Effects

Even oily skin can experience side effects from effective pimple treatments that use benzoyl peroxide. The side effects, however, usually occur when people apply too much of the product. Many teens, for instance, think that applying a larger amount will help them eliminate pimples more quickly. Using a larger dose, however, is not an effective pimple treatment.

Using the products more frequently will not present positive results either. If your acne product says to use it twice daily, then that is the maximum number of times that you should use it. In fact, it’s a good idea to start with a single application each day. That way you can make sure that the benzoyl peroxide and other ingredients don’t cause any negative responses.
